AI Agent Management: Complete Guide for Remote Teams

📅 Published on: 2025-06-20👤 By: RepoBird Team
RepoBird
AI Development
Agent
Management

Managing AI agents in remote teams requires a fundamentally different approach than traditional software development workflows. As organizations increasingly adopt autonomous AI solutions like RepoBird to accelerate development cycles, understanding how to effectively orchestrate these digital workers becomes crucial for maintaining productivity and code quality. This comprehensive guide explores proven strategies for building, training, and managing AI agent teams that seamlessly integrate with your existing remote workforce. Whether you're scaling from a single AI assistant to a full fleet of specialized agents, these best practices will help you maximize ROI while maintaining the human oversight necessary for successful implementation.

Quick Takeaways

  • Start simple: Begin with basic task automation before scaling to complex multi-agent systems
  • Clear interfaces matter: Well-defined agent-computer interfaces (ACI) are as important as human-computer interfaces
  • Monitor continuously: Real-time performance tracking prevents compound errors and maintains quality
  • Human-AI collaboration: Define explicit handoff procedures and communication protocols
  • Security first: Implement proper guardrails and sandboxed testing environments
  • Knowledge precision: Tailor knowledge bases specifically to each agent's purpose
  • Measure ROI: Track KPIs including task completion rates, error frequency, and time savings

Understanding AI Agents in Modern Development

The evolution from simple automation scripts to sophisticated AI agents represents a paradigm shift in how development teams operate. Modern AI agents aren't just tools that execute predefined commands—they're intelligent systems capable of understanding context, making decisions, and adapting to new situations.

Types of AI Agents for Software Teams

Software development teams typically deploy three categories of AI agents. Code generation agents like RepoBird analyze entire codebases to create production-ready pull requests that follow existing patterns and conventions. These agents understand dependencies, respect architectural decisions, and write tests alongside implementation code. Testing and QA agents automatically identify edge cases, generate comprehensive test suites, and perform regression testing across multiple environments. They can simulate user behavior, stress test APIs, and ensure code coverage meets team standards. Documentation agents maintain up-to-date technical documentation by analyzing code changes, generating API references, and creating user guides that reflect the current system state.

Key Capabilities and Limitations

Modern AI agents excel at pattern recognition, enabling them to identify coding conventions, security vulnerabilities, and optimization opportunities across large codebases. They process information at scales impossible for human developers, analyzing thousands of files simultaneously while maintaining context. However, agents still struggle with highly creative problem-solving that requires intuitive leaps or understanding implicit business requirements not captured in code. They may also generate plausible-looking but incorrect solutions—a phenomenon known as hallucination—making human oversight essential for critical decisions.

AI Agents vs Traditional Automation

Traditional automation follows rigid, predetermined paths with if-then logic and scripted responses. AI agents, conversely, interpret intent, adapt to unexpected scenarios, and learn from outcomes. Where a traditional CI/CD pipeline might fail when encountering an unfamiliar error, an AI agent can analyze the error context, search for similar issues, and propose solutions. This adaptability makes AI agents particularly valuable for remote teams dealing with diverse technology stacks and evolving requirements.

Building Your Remote AI Agent Infrastructure

Creating a robust infrastructure for AI agent management requires careful planning and the right technological foundation. The goal is establishing an environment where agents can operate efficiently while maintaining security and reliability standards essential for production systems.

Essential Tools and Platforms

The foundation of any AI agent infrastructure starts with a comprehensive orchestration platform that manages agent lifecycles, handles resource allocation, and provides centralized monitoring. Platforms like Kubernetes with custom operators can scale agent deployments based on workload demands. Version control integration ensures agents always work with the latest code while maintaining audit trails of their actions. Tools like GitHub Actions or GitLab CI/CD pipelines can trigger agent workflows based on repository events. Communication middleware facilitates seamless interaction between agents, human team members, and external services. Message queuing systems like RabbitMQ or Apache Kafka enable asynchronous communication patterns that prevent bottlenecks.

Integration with Existing Workflows

Successful AI agent deployment requires thoughtful integration with established development practices. Start by mapping current workflows to identify automation opportunities without disrupting productive routines. Implement agents gradually, beginning with low-risk tasks like code formatting or dependency updates before progressing to complex features. Create clear API contracts between agents and existing tools, ensuring compatibility with IDEs, project management systems, and communication platforms your team already uses. This approach minimizes resistance to adoption while demonstrating immediate value.

Security and Compliance Considerations

Security must be embedded throughout your AI agent infrastructure. Implement principle of least privilege by granting agents only the minimum permissions required for their tasks. Use OAuth tokens with limited scopes rather than personal access tokens. Establish sandboxed environments where agents can be tested safely before production deployment. These isolated spaces should mirror production configurations while preventing access to sensitive data. Enable comprehensive audit logging that tracks every agent action, decision, and data access. These logs prove invaluable for debugging, compliance reporting, and security incident investigation.

Onboarding AI Agents: Best Practices

Properly onboarding AI agents sets the foundation for their long-term effectiveness. This process goes beyond simple installation—it requires careful configuration, training, and integration with team practices.

Initial Setup and Configuration

Begin onboarding by clearly defining each agent's purpose and scope. Document specific problems the agent will solve and explicit boundaries for its operation. Configure environment-specific settings including API endpoints, authentication credentials, and resource limits. Establish naming conventions that make agent roles immediately clear to team members. For example, "ReviewBot-Security" instantly communicates an agent focused on security code reviews. Create detailed runbooks documenting setup procedures, troubleshooting steps, and rollback processes.

Training and Fine-tuning Strategies

Effective agent training requires high-quality, relevant data that reflects your team's actual work patterns. Start by feeding agents examples of excellent code from your repositories, including commit messages, PR descriptions, and code review comments. This helps agents understand your team's communication style and technical standards. Implement iterative refinement cycles where agent outputs are reviewed, corrected, and fed back as training data. Use techniques like few-shot learning to help agents adapt quickly to new patterns or technologies. Monitor agent confidence scores and flag low-confidence outputs for human review, creating a feedback loop that continuously improves performance.

Creating Knowledge Bases

Build focused knowledge bases tailored to each agent's specific responsibilities. Avoid the temptation to provide all available documentation—information overload degrades agent performance just as it does human performance. Structure knowledge hierarchically, with core concepts at the top level and implementation details in subsections. Include explicit examples of correct and incorrect approaches, helping agents understand nuanced decisions. Regular knowledge base maintenance ensures agents work with current information. Establish a review cycle synchronized with major project milestones or technology updates.

Setting Performance Benchmarks

Define measurable success criteria before deploying agents to production. Establish baseline metrics for task completion time, accuracy rates, and resource consumption. Set realistic initial targets—agents typically require adjustment periods before reaching optimal performance. Create dashboards displaying real-time performance against benchmarks, enabling quick identification of degradation or improvement opportunities. Include both technical metrics (response time, error rates) and business metrics (developer satisfaction, time saved) to ensure agents deliver genuine value beyond raw automation.

Managing AI Agent Workflows

Effective workflow management transforms individual AI agents into coordinated teams that amplify remote team productivity. The key lies in creating systems that maximize agent autonomy while maintaining human oversight for critical decisions.

Task Allocation and Prioritization

Implement intelligent task routing that matches agent capabilities with work requirements. Create a skills matrix documenting each agent's strengths, limitations, and performance history across different task types. For instance, deploy specialized agents for frontend versus backend tasks rather than expecting universal competence. Develop priority queues that consider deadline urgency, business impact, and resource availability. Implement load balancing algorithms that prevent agent overload while ensuring efficient resource utilization. Build escalation procedures that automatically route complex or ambiguous tasks to human developers when agents encounter scenarios beyond their training.

Workflow Orchestration Techniques

Design workflows that leverage agent strengths while accommodating their limitations. Implement pipeline architectures where agents handle specific stages—code generation, testing, documentation—with clear handoff points. Use event-driven architectures that trigger agent actions based on repository changes, issue creation, or scheduled intervals. Create feedback loops where downstream agents validate upstream outputs, catching errors before they propagate. For complex features, orchestrate multiple specialized agents working in parallel on different components, with a coordinator agent managing integration points.

Real-time Monitoring Systems

Deploy comprehensive monitoring that provides visibility into agent operations without overwhelming operators. Implement distributed tracing that follows tasks across multiple agents and systems, revealing bottlenecks and failure points. Create custom metrics relevant to your workflow—PR creation time, test coverage improvements, documentation completeness scores. Set up intelligent alerting that distinguishes between transient issues and systemic problems requiring intervention. Use anomaly detection to identify unusual agent behavior patterns that might indicate degraded performance or security concerns. Maintain dashboards accessible to all team members, fostering transparency and trust in agent operations.

Error Handling and Troubleshooting

Develop robust error handling strategies that prevent cascading failures while maintaining system resilience. Implement circuit breakers that temporarily disable malfunctioning agents rather than allowing continued errors. Create detailed error taxonomies that classify failures by type, severity, and required response. Build self-healing capabilities where agents can automatically retry failed operations with exponential backoff. Document common error patterns and their solutions in a shared knowledge base accessible to both humans and agents. Establish clear escalation paths that route unresolvable errors to appropriate human experts based on technical domain and availability.

Human-AI Collaboration Strategies

Success with AI agents depends on creating synergistic relationships where human creativity and agent efficiency amplify each other. This requires intentional design of interaction patterns, communication protocols, and trust-building mechanisms.

Defining Clear Roles and Responsibilities

Establish explicit boundaries between human and agent responsibilities based on task characteristics. Humans excel at strategic planning, creative problem-solving, and stakeholder communication—tasks requiring empathy, context understanding, and judgment. Agents handle repetitive tasks, large-scale analysis, and consistent policy enforcement. Document these divisions in team handbooks, ensuring everyone understands when to engage agents versus human colleagues. Create RACI matrices (Responsible, Accountable, Consulted, Informed) that include AI agents as team members, clarifying their participation in different processes.

Communication Protocols

Develop standardized communication patterns that make human-agent interaction intuitive and efficient. Implement structured command languages that reduce ambiguity—for example, using specific keywords to trigger different agent behaviors. Create feedback mechanisms where humans can easily correct agent outputs, with these corrections automatically incorporated into training data. Establish notification preferences that alert humans to agent actions requiring review without creating alert fatigue. Design conversational interfaces that allow natural language interaction while maintaining precision through confirmation dialogs and clarification requests.

Handoff Procedures

Create seamless transitions between human and agent work phases. Implement detailed context preservation ensuring no information is lost during handoffs. For instance, when an agent creates a pull request, it should include comprehensive documentation of decisions made, alternatives considered, and areas requiring human review. Establish clear ownership transfer protocols—when does responsibility shift from agent to human and vice versa? Build validation checkpoints where humans verify agent work before critical milestones. Design rollback procedures enabling quick reversion if agent outputs don't meet standards after human review.

Building Trust with Team Members

Foster trust through transparency, reliability, and gradual capability demonstration. Start with low-stakes tasks where mistakes have minimal impact, allowing team members to observe agent capabilities without risk. Share agent decision-making processes—explainable AI techniques help humans understand how agents reach conclusions. Celebrate successful human-agent collaborations publicly, highlighting time saved and quality improvements. Address concerns directly, acknowledging that agents augment rather than replace human developers. Create feedback channels where team members can report issues or suggest improvements, demonstrating that human input drives agent evolution.

Performance Monitoring and Optimization

Continuous performance monitoring and optimization ensure AI agents deliver sustained value while adapting to evolving team needs. This requires comprehensive metrics, analysis tools, and improvement processes.

Key Performance Indicators (KPIs)

Track metrics that reflect both operational efficiency and business value. Productivity metrics include task completion rates, average handling time, and throughput variations across different work types. Monitor how many pull requests agents create, their acceptance rates, and time-to-merge compared to human-generated PRs. Quality metrics encompass error rates, test coverage improvements, and code review feedback patterns. Track whether agent-generated code requires more revisions than human-written code. Efficiency metrics measure resource utilization, cost per task, and ROI calculations comparing agent costs to equivalent human effort. Satisfaction metrics gauge developer happiness through surveys, adoption rates, and voluntary agent usage for optional tasks.

Analytics and Reporting Tools

Implement analytics platforms that transform raw performance data into actionable insights. Use time-series databases to track metric evolution, identifying trends and seasonal patterns. Deploy machine learning models that predict performance degradation before it impacts productivity. Create role-specific dashboards—executives see ROI and strategic metrics while developers view technical performance indicators. Implement comparative analytics showing agent performance across different projects, technologies, and team compositions. Build automated reporting systems that generate weekly summaries highlighting achievements, issues, and improvement opportunities.

Continuous Improvement Processes

Establish systematic approaches to enhance agent capabilities based on performance data and team feedback. Conduct regular retrospectives analyzing agent successes and failures, identifying patterns that inform training updates. Implement A/B testing frameworks comparing different agent configurations or training approaches. Create feedback loops where performance metrics automatically trigger retraining when thresholds are breached. Document lessons learned in a shared repository, building institutional knowledge about effective agent management. Establish centers of excellence where teams share best practices and collaborate on agent improvements. Schedule regular agent "health checks" reviewing configurations, permissions, and integration points to ensure optimal operation.

Real-World Implementation Examples

Learning from successful implementations provides practical insights that accelerate your own AI agent adoption. These examples demonstrate how different organizations have navigated common challenges while achieving significant productivity gains.

Case Studies from Successful Teams

Global FinTech Scaling Development: A financial services company with distributed teams across three continents implemented RepoBird to manage their growing technical debt. They started with simple code refactoring tasks, allowing their AI agents to identify and fix deprecated API usage across their microservices architecture. Within three months, agents were handling 40% of routine maintenance tasks, freeing senior developers to focus on new feature development. The key to success was their phased approach—beginning with read-only analysis tasks before granting write permissions, and establishing clear review processes where senior developers validated agent-generated changes before merging.

E-commerce Platform Acceleration: An online marketplace struggling with slow feature delivery deployed specialized AI agents for different aspects of their development pipeline. Frontend agents handled UI component updates and accessibility improvements, while backend agents optimized database queries and API endpoints. They achieved a 3x improvement in feature delivery speed by orchestrating agents to work on parallel workstreams. Their breakthrough came from treating agents as specialized team members rather than generic tools, with dedicated "agent handlers" who became experts in maximizing each agent's capabilities.

Common Pitfalls and Solutions

Over-automation Syndrome: Teams often attempt to automate everything immediately, leading to chaos and reduced trust in AI systems. The solution involves careful scope definition and gradual expansion. Start with well-defined, low-risk tasks and expand only after achieving consistent success. Create explicit automation boundaries that preserve human control over critical decisions.

Knowledge Base Bloat: Providing agents with excessive documentation often degrades performance as they struggle to identify relevant information. Successful teams maintain focused, curated knowledge bases tailored to specific agent roles. Regular pruning removes outdated information while targeted additions address identified gaps.

Integration Conflicts: Agents operating in isolation from existing tools create workflow friction. Teams succeed by prioritizing deep integration with current development environments. This means agents that comment directly in pull requests, update project management tools, and communicate through established channels rather than requiring separate interfaces.

Metrics Myopia: Focusing solely on quantitative metrics misses important qualitative factors like code maintainability and team morale. Balanced scorecards incorporating both hard metrics and subjective assessments provide more accurate pictures of agent impact. Regular developer surveys reveal issues that metrics might miss.

Frequently Asked Questions

What is AI agent management and why is it important for remote teams?

AI agent management encompasses the strategies, tools, and processes used to deploy, monitor, and optimize autonomous AI systems within development workflows. For remote teams, effective agent management bridges timezone gaps, maintains consistent code quality across distributed contributors, and accelerates development cycles. It's particularly important because remote teams lack the informal coordination mechanisms of co-located groups, making systematic agent orchestration essential for maintaining productivity and alignment.

How do I measure ROI for AI agent management systems?

Calculate ROI by comparing total agent costs (licensing, infrastructure, training, management overhead) against value delivered through time savings, quality improvements, and opportunity costs. Track metrics like developer hours saved per sprint, reduction in bug rates, faster time-to-market for features, and improved developer satisfaction scores. A typical calculation might show that if an agent saves 10 developer hours weekly at $100/hour while costing $200/week to operate, the weekly ROI is 400%.

What skills do team members need to effectively manage AI agents?

Effective AI agent management requires a blend of technical and soft skills. Technical competencies include understanding API design, workflow orchestration, basic machine learning concepts, and debugging distributed systems. Equally important are soft skills like systems thinking to design effective workflows, communication abilities to translate between human and agent requirements, and change management expertise to guide team adoption. Most valuable are "hybrid" professionals who combine software development experience with AI literacy.

Can AI agents really replace human developers on remote teams?

AI agents augment rather than replace human developers. While agents excel at repetitive tasks, pattern-based problem solving, and large-scale analysis, humans remain essential for creative problem solving, stakeholder communication, and strategic decision making. The most successful teams use agents to eliminate routine work, allowing developers to focus on high-value activities that require human judgment, creativity, and empathy. Think of agents as extremely capable assistants rather than replacements.

How do I ensure security when deploying AI agents with repository access?

Security requires multiple layers of protection. Implement principle of least privilege, granting agents minimal necessary permissions with time-limited tokens. Use separate service accounts for each agent with detailed audit logging. Deploy agents in isolated environments with network segmentation preventing lateral movement. Regularly rotate credentials and conduct security audits reviewing agent permissions and access patterns. Consider implementing additional controls like requiring human approval for sensitive operations or changes to critical code paths.

Conclusion

Successfully managing AI agents in remote teams requires balancing automation capabilities with human oversight, technical infrastructure with team dynamics, and immediate productivity gains with long-term sustainability. As we've explored throughout this guide, the key lies not in maximizing automation but in creating synergistic human-AI partnerships that amplify team capabilities.

The journey begins with careful planning—selecting appropriate tools, defining clear boundaries, and establishing robust monitoring systems. But success ultimately depends on how well you integrate agents into your team's unique culture and workflows. Start small with focused experiments, measure results comprehensively, and scale based on demonstrated value rather than theoretical potential.

As AI agents become increasingly sophisticated, teams that master their management will enjoy significant competitive advantages. They'll deliver higher quality code faster while their developers focus on creative challenges that drive business value. The future of software development isn't about choosing between humans or AI—it's about orchestrating both to achieve what neither could accomplish alone.

Ready to transform your remote development team with AI agents? Start with RepoBird's proven platform that seamlessly integrates with your GitHub workflow. Our agents understand your codebase, follow your conventions, and deliver production-ready pull requests that accelerate your development cycle. Visit repobird.ai to begin your free trial and experience the future of AI-powered development.


Share Your Experience

Have you implemented AI agents in your remote development team? We'd love to hear about your experiences, challenges, and successes. Join the conversation in our community forum or reach out directly at feedback@repobird.ai. Your insights help shape the future of AI agent management best practices.


References

  1. Microsoft News. (2024). "AI agents — what they are, and how they'll change the way we work." Microsoft Source. Retrieved from https://news.microsoft.com/source/features/ai/ai-agents-what-they-are-and-how-theyll-change-the-way-we-work/

  2. Salesforce Blog. (2024). "AI and remote work: how AI agents keep hybrid work teams aligned." Retrieved from https://www.salesforce.com/blog/ai-and-remote-work/

  3. Anthropic. (2024). "Building Effective AI Agents." Anthropic Engineering Blog. Retrieved from https://www.anthropic.com/engineering/building-effective-agents

  4. BCG. (2024). "AI Agents: What They Are and Their Business Impact." Boston Consulting Group. Retrieved from https://www.bcg.com/capabilities/artificial-intelligence/ai-agents

  5. PwC. (2024). "AI agents can reimagine the future of work, your workforce and workers." PricewaterhouseCoopers. Retrieved from https://www.pwc.com/us/en/tech-effect/ai-analytics/ai-agents.html